Crafting Captivating Web Experiences
Delivering a truly powerful web experience requires a creative approach. Start by analyzing your primary audience and their needs. Develop content that is both relevant and simple to {consume|. Integrate interactive elements to boost engagement. more info And never discount the value of a user-friendly design that guides a effortless user journey.
Test your web experience consistently to discover areas for improvement. Incessantly strive to adapt your strategies based on user feedback and market trends.
Cutting-Edge Front-End Frameworks Demystified
Navigating the terrain of modern front-end frameworks can feel like traversing a dense jungle. With an array of alternatives available, from the robust React to the lightweight Vue, choosing the optimal framework for your project can seem daunting. Fear not! This article aims to unravel the intricacies of these popular frameworks, providing you with the understanding needed to make an informed decision.
- Let's the core concepts and features of each framework, exploring their syntax, support, and deployments.
- In conclusion, you'll gain a clearer understanding of which framework suits your project requirements, empowering you to build stunning front-end experiences.
Constructing Robust Back-End Systems
A robust back-end system is critical for any thriving web application. It provides the backbone upon which your front-end interacts, handling all intricate tasks under the scenes. To secure its stability and reliability, it's crucial to implement best practices throughout the development process.
First, consider choosing a reliable programming language and framework that are well-suited for your project's needs. Next, invest in thorough testing at every stage of development to detect potential issues.
Additionally, implement robust error handling mechanisms to reduce downtime and ensure a seamless user experience. Periodically monitor your system's performance and optimize it as needed to accommodate growing traffic and data demands.
- Focus on security measures to protect sensitive user data from harmful access.
- Deploy version control systems to track changes and support collaboration among developers.
Via adhering to these principles, you can build a robust back-end system that is resilient and capable of withstanding the demands of your application.
Conquering Responsive Design Principles
Crafting compelling user experiences throughout various devices demands a thorough understanding of responsive design principles. A well-structured layout ensures seamless navigation and optimal content visibility regardless of the screen dimensions. By utilizing flexible grids, flexible images, and media queries, developers can enhance websites to adapt gracefully with different platforms.
- Emphasize mobile-first development
- Leverage fluid grid
- Incorporate responsive images for enhanced display
- Test your designs with a range of devices and monitor sizes
A commitment to responsive design ensures a positive user experience at all audiences, improving website usability.
Boosting Performance for Speed and Scalability
Achieving optimal performance in any system is a crucial objective. It involves meticulously selecting the right architectures to ensure both speed and scalability. To enhance speed, focus on minimizing bottlenecks, such as inefficient algorithms or excessive data access.
Scalability refers to a system's ability to adapt gracefully under increasing workloads. This often involves implementing distributed systems to distribute the workload across multiple instances. Regularly assess your system's performance, using tools like profiling and performance testing to identify areas for improvement. By fine-tuning your system, you can ensure it remains agile even as demands increase.
Crafting the Blend
Web development is a a fascinating fusion of artistic vision and technical prowess. On one hand, it demands a keen eye for aesthetics and user experience, crafting interfaces that are both visually appealing and intuitively navigable. On the other hand, it requires a deep mastery in programming languages and web technologies, enabling developers to build functional and robust websites. Mastering this meeting point of art and science paves the way for developers to create online experiences that are not only visually stunning but also technically sound.
- Designing websites that incorporate visually appealing and user-friendly
- Employing programming languages and web technologies to build functional applications
- Balancing creative vision with technical expertise